File Upload widget of any kind (PrimeFaces, ICEFaces, etc) does not work when it is on top of a PE LayoutPane
FileUpload widget needs to be enclosed in a form of enctype="multipart/form-data"

However, when running, the form enctype is rendered as:

form enctype="application/x-www-form-urlencoded" action=".../myPage.jsf" method="post" name="mainForm" id="mainForm">

If I chance the enctype manually using firefox, it seems to work.

I tried it with p:layout and it works!

When I use pe:layoutpane, the enctype of h:form gets overriden for some reason.

I tried copying the generic fileupload simple from Primefaces into a p:layout and it works, but if I copy the same into a pe:layoutpane, it doesn't.

Code: Select all

<h:panelGroup id="layoutsContainer">   
  
    <h:panelGrid id="layoutsGrid" columns="2" style="margin-top: 15px;" cellpadding="0" cellspacing="0">  

        <pe:layout fullPage="false" style="width:450px; height:220px;"  
                   rendered="#{layoutController.layoutOneShown}" state="#{layoutController.stateOne}">  

            <pe:layoutPane position="west" size="150" minSize="40" maxSize="300">  
                Left  
            </pe:layoutPane>  

            <pe:layoutPane position="center">  
				<h:form enctype="multipart/form-data">  
				  
				    <p:messages showDetail="true"/>  
				  
				    <p:fileUpload value="#{fileUploadController.file}" mode="simple"/>  
				  
				    <p:commandButton value="Submit" ajax="false" actionListener="#{fileUploadController.upload}"/>  
				  
				</h:form>  
            </pe:layoutPane>  

        </pe:layout>  
  
    </h:panelGrid>  
</h:panelGroup>
